1,077,941 Shares in Kratos Defense & Security Solutions, Inc. $KTOS Purchased by Bamco Inc. NY

Kratos Defense & Security Solutions logo with Industrials background
Image from MarketBeat Media, LLC.

Bamco Inc. NY purchased a new stake in Kratos Defense & Security Solutions, Inc. (NASDAQ:KTOS - Free Report) during the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or purchased 1,077,941 shares of the aerospace company's stock, valued at approximately $53,746,000. Bamco Inc. NY owned about 0.57% of Kratos Defense & Security Solutions as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

About Kratos Defense & Security Solutions

(Free Report)

Kratos Defense & Security Solutions, Inc NASDAQ: KTOS is a technology-driven company that specializes in national security and defense solutions for government and military customers. The firm’s core capabilities span unmanned systems, satellite communications, missile defense, cyber security, and directed-energy weapons. Through its integrated approach, Kratos delivers mission-critical products and services designed to enhance operational readiness and support force modernization initiatives.

In the unmanned systems arena, Kratos develops high-performance aerial platforms used as target drones, low-cost attritable aircraft and experimental stealth demonstrators.
